Assassin’s Creed Black Flag Resynced Team Has “DLC Ideas,” But Freedom Cry Remains Up in the Air

Game director Richard Knight reiterates the team's focus on Edward Kenway, who is the "heart and soul of the original game."

As the dust begins to settle on Assassin’s Creed Black Flag Resynced, which sold a whopping 3 million-plus copies in about a week, Ubisoft Singapore is looking forward to what’s next. Besides the first major Title Update and addressing feedback from fans, it’s also working on New Game Plus. But what about DLC (and no, not the Character and Naval Packs that drew controversy despite reportedly selling well)?

In an interview with YouTuber JorRaptor, game director Richard Knight said, “I know some folks on the team have DLC ideas. We need to balance those out with our future, and then update the core game.”

However, it’s keen on keeping Edward Kenway as the focus since he’s the “heart and soul of the original game.” “Maybe there could be more to tell there too,” says Knight. Unfortunately, you probably shouldn’t expect Freedom Cry to emerge in some form or another.

“I can’t really say anything as to a Freedom Cry. We’ve got our hands full with this game right now. Freedom Cry, it’s not a small thing either.” So it’s not a hard “no,” but you shouldn’t get your hopes up. For now, the developer is still figuring things out– once that happens, we may have a clearer roadmap for the future.

For now, Assassin’s Creed Black Flag Resynced is absolutely worth playing, whether you played the original or not. Besides the overhauled visuals, combat and parkour mechanics, it adds tons of new content, including more discoveries on its existing islands, expanded Hideout features, and dedicated end-game missions.

There are also three new officers to recruit, each with their own questlines, and story missions that offer closure to beloved characters like Blackbeard and Stede Bonnet. Check out our review for more details.
